How far is Windsor from the Brisbane central business district?
Windsor is located about 3.5 kilometres (approximately 2‑3 miles) from the Brisbane CBD. This close proximity provides easy access to the city centre.
What public transport options are available near 52A Hooker Street?
The Windsor railway station is just 0.2 km away, offering regular Queensland Rail City network services to destinations such as Ferny Grove, Brisbane and Beenleigh. This provides convenient train travel for residents.
Which heritage‑listed historic sites are within walking distance of the property?
Several heritage sites are nearby, including Oakwal (0.1 km) and Boothville House (0.2 km). Within 0.5‑1 km you’ll also find Rosemount Hospital, Skilmorlie, the Windsor Shire Council Chambers and the Windsor War Memorial Park.
What parks and community amenities are close to 52A Hooker Street?
Downey Park, known as the ‘home of women’s sport in Brisbane’, is about 0.7 km away, and the Northey St City Farm is just next to it, offering hands‑on agricultural activities and a Sunday market.
Is there a health‑related organization near the property?
The Institute for Urban Indigenous Health is located only 0.1 km from the address, providing health services and community support within the Windsor area.
What is the population of Windsor according to the most recent census?
The 2021 census recorded a population of 7,811 people living in Windsor. The suburb has grown steadily, reflecting its popularity as an inner‑northern Brisbane location.
